AETNA (CVS HEALTH) PRIOR AUTHORIZATION IN OH

Prior auth required for high-tech radiology, genetic testing, specialty pharmacy infusions, and spinal surgery. Requires Clinical Policy Bulletin (CPB) evidence matching.
